jquery和jquery ui的区别是什么?
区别:1、jquery是一个js库,提供选择器、属性修改、事件绑定等功能;而jquery ui是基于jQuery的插件;2、jQuery本身注重于后台,没有漂亮的界面,而jQuery UI提供了华丽的展示界面,既有后台界面,又有前台界面。
认识jQuery
jQuery是一个快速、简洁的JavaScript框架,是继Prototype之后又一个优秀的JavaScript代码库(或JavaScript框架)。【相关推荐:jQuery视频教程】
jQuery设计的宗旨是“write Less,Do More”,即倡导写更少的代码,做更多的事情。它封装JavaScript常用的功能代码,提供一种简便的JavaScript设计模式,优化HTML文档操作、事件处理、动画设计和Ajax交互。
认识jQuery UI
jQuery UI是以 jQuery为基础的开源JavaScript 网页用户界面代码库。包含底层用户交互、动画、特效和可更换主题的可视控件。我们可以直接用它来构建具有很好交互性的web应用程序。所有插件测试能兼容IE 6.0+, Firefox 3+, Safari 3.1+, Opera 9.6+, 和GoogleChrome。
jQuery UI包含了许多维持状态的小部件(Widget),因此,它与典型的 jQuery 插件使用模式略有不同。所有的 jQuery UI 小部件(Widget)使用相同的模式,所以,只要您学会使用其中一个,您就知道如何使用其他的小部件(Widget)。
jQuery UI主要分为3部分:交互、微件、效果库。
交互:交互部件是一些与鼠标交互相关的内容,包括缩放、拖动、放置、选择、排序等。
小部件:主要是一些界面的扩展,包括折叠面板、自动完成、按钮、日期选择器、对话框、菜单、进度条、滑块、旋转器、标签页、工具提示框等。
效果库:丰富的动画效果,包括特效、显示、隐藏、切换、添加class、移除class等。
jquery和jquery ui的区别
jQuery是一个js库,主要提供的功能是选择器、属性修改和事件绑定等;
jQuery UI则是在jQuery的基础上,利用jQuery的扩展性而设计的插件。提供了一些常用的界面元素,诸如对话框、拖动行为、改变大小行为等;
jQuery本身注重于后台,没有漂亮的界面,而jQuery UI则补充了前者的不足,他提供了华丽的展示界面,使人更容易接受。既有强大的后台,又有华丽的前台。jQuery UI是jQuery插件,只不过专指由jQuery官方维护的UI方向的插件。
更多编程相关知识,请访问:编程视频课程!!
以上就是jquery和jquery ui的区别是什么?的详细内容,更多请关注其它相关文章!
上一篇: Python 如何编写交互界面?
下一篇: 浅谈JVM - 内存结构(五)- 堆
推荐阅读
-
jQuery调用AJAX时Get和post公用的乱码解决方法实例说明
-
jQuery实现table隔行换色和鼠标经过变色的两种方法
-
jquery中的查找parents与closest方法之间的区别
-
笔记本的睡眠和休眠区别是什么?如何使用
-
网站定制开发和模板建站的具体区别是什么?
-
HTML5新增属性data-*和js/jquery之间的交互及注意事项
-
JavaScript和JQuery获取DIV值的方法示例
-
jQuery中bind,live,delegate与one方法的用法及区别解析
-
jQuery 源码解析(七) jQuery对象和DOM对象的互相转换
-
使用jQuery实现一个类似GridView的编辑,更新,取消和删除的功能